Bulgur and Kidney beans stuffed Aubergine – Baked
About:
This is a delicious healthy meal where the fillings can be customised as per choice. This can be served as a main dish Or a starter skipping bulgur filling. I love the texture of eggplant, which is soft and gives a crunchy roasted flavour especially when contrasted with bean and rice filling. It is aromatic with whole spices which tantalises the taste buds
Health Benefits:
Aubergine or Brinjal, is a very low calorie vegetable and has healthy nutrition profile. The peel or skin (deep blue/purple varieties) of aubergine has significant amounts of antioxidants which helps to fight against cancer, aging, inflammation, and neurological disease.

Capsicum, Broad beans with baby potatoes gravy
About:
This recipe is a flavourful curry in tomato onion gravy with aroma of Indian spices resulting in a delightful and palatable experience to taste buds. I sauted bell peppers before adding to the gravy just for the crunchiness, it can also be cooked in the gravy and tomatoes can be sauted along with onions and Baby potatoes adds texture.
Health Benefits:
Better beans knows as fava, butter, Windsor, horse or even English beans. Adding just a handful of these beans provides a boost of protein, fiber, potassium and energy-providing B vitamins.
